Map Size
It’s Massive
Rockstar is no stranger to making big maps, as Red Dead Redemption 2 and Grand Theft Auto 5 both have impressive map sizes. However, they pale in comparison to the map size of Grand Theft Auto 6.
You might be wondering how much bigger Leonida is compared to past games. Well, as confirmed by Rockstar, the GTA 6 map is three times bigger than the map in Red Dead Redemption 2. Of course, I am talking about the playable area of the map in that game.
When compared to GTA 5, Vice City in GTA 6 is twice the size of Los Santos. Vice City and the surrounding areas are nearly 11 times larger than the city in GTA 5. To top it all off, there are hundreds of buildings that you can access to make the map seem even bigger.

Improved Wanted System
Outwit the Cops
The cops in Grand Theft Auto 6 are far more intelligent than those in past titles. I am sure you have found it easy to escape the cops in GTA 5. After all, there is a tunnel that you can drive through that makes the cops lose you even when you have a five-star wanted level.
You won’t be having luck like that in GTA 6, as there are various mechanics that make dodging the police much more difficult. For instance, cops will remember your face if you don’t wear a mask, they will track your car so you have to get a new one, and they will even keep tabs on what clothes you were wearing.
All of this makes avoiding getting caught much more difficult, but it will be extremely satisfying when you finally get away from the police because you outwitted them.

More Skill Required
Less Duck and Shoot
Something about GTA 5 that made shootouts feel far too easy was the lock-on. You can easily duck behind cover, aim, and snap the reticle onto a target without needing to use any skill.
At that point, all you need to do is point and shoot with no skill involved. Well, GTA 6 strays away from this, as the lock-on system has been removed and a free aim system is utilized instead.
Along with this, there are now multiple hit markers, with white markers appearing when you hit an enemy, yellow appearing when you incapacitate them, and red appearing when you kill them. This makes the combat much more intricate than it was in previous titles.

Non-Linear Heists
Be More Adaptive
Heists have tended to be a bit linear in past GTA titles. GTA 5 has plenty of heists, but many of them have set routes, or have a few select routes you can take to get in, complete the mission, and escape.
The toying around with heists in GTA 5, however, has seemed to drastically help the heists in Grand Theft Auto 6, as they aren’t nearly as linear. This also applies to jobs like robberies or boosting cars.
Taking longer to do things carefully may result in the police showing up. Going in fast may result in you damaging your loot. Along with this, missions have more adaptive routes, allowing you to take the path you feel most strongly about.

Reactive NPCs
That Know How To Act
The NPCs of past games Rockstar has developed aren’t the best. Take a look at GTA 5. The NPCs largely run away from you if you pull out a gun, and few, if any, will fight back. They let you walk all over them for the most part.
This is a major change in GTA 6, as the NPCs are far more reactive. For instance, you can choose to eavesdrop on conversations, and if you are caught, NPCs will confront you. This also happens if you happen to follow an NPC on the street for too long.
On top of this, Rockstar has made it clear that you aren’t the only citizen of Leonida who owns a gun and carries it around. Being too aggressive can cause you to end up in a shootout. Listening in on conversations can also lead to new activities, making the world far more reactive to your actions than ever before.

Spontaneous Quests and Events
A Break From Linear Style
Grand Theft Auto 6 has a bigger world and more adaptive world. It reacts on the fly sometimes, and that becomes apparent when you explore.
First, there are event missions that happen on the fly. An example that was given is a lawyer who can appear, and gifting him some drugs will get you some legal advice. Along with this, Jason and Lucia will sometimes suggest nearby jobs and activities.
Listening to what they have to say and taking them up on the offer can result in a new mission that you might not have discovered had you chose to ignore them. This is a major change from the more campaign-focused games Rockstar has produced, allowing for more activities to take place within the world of Leonida.

A Focus On Relationships
That Alters The Story
Rockstar is no stranger to making a design where your decisions matter when playing a game. For instance, when robbing the bank in Valentine in Red Dead Redemption 2, you can choose to blow up the safe, but it draws some major attention.
There is no doubt that GTA 6 will have some major story beats where you will need to make a decision that will alter the course of the story in some way or change the mission you are on. However, one of the biggest changes that sets it apart from the previous entries is its focus on your relationship.
Lucia and Jason can spend a lot of time together, and even complete heists as a couple. This time spent together builds on their relationship, which will have major implications in the story, affecting how their story plays out, making things much more personal.
